Company Information Bennett Lumber Products, Inc. (BLP) owns two sawmill processing facilities: Bennett Lumber Products, Inc. in Princeton, ID and Guy Bennett Lumber Company in Clarkston, WA. Bennett Lumber Products produces quality dimension and board lumber. Logs are procured from fee lands, open market (gatewood) and purchased stumpage sales. The headquarters and corporate officers are located at the Princeton, ID facility. Multi-Site Requirements Bennett Lumber Products is a multi-site organization and has a central office or headquarters (Princeton, ID) at which certain activities are planned, controlled or managed. The Princeton, ID central office provides both sawmill facilities with information and guidance on activities. The scope and scale of activities are similar at both sites. Each facility operates under a common fiber sourcing system, policies and set of procedures that is managed and administered by the central office. For multi-site certifications, a site sampling method is generally used. The number of sites to be audited is equal to the square of the number of sites x 0.8 for surveillance audits. A site sampling method was used and both sites plus headquarters are to be audited on an annual basis. Bennett Lumber Products continues to be in conformance with all multi-site requirements. Objective 1-Biodiversity in Fiber Sourcing: BLP promotes biological diversity by providing information on their website (landowner resources) and in the Sustainable Forestry Handbook for Logging Contractors. BLP in participation with the Idaho SFI-SIC provided input to the Idaho Fish and Game in development of the Statewide Wildlife Action Plan (SWAP). Bennett Lumber also participates in and supports the annual Family Forest Landowner s Conference and Foresters Forum. No FECV has been identified within the operating area on private ownership. Some FECV has been identified on State and Federal Lands and are managed by those agencies. Objective 2-Adherence to Best Management Practices: Approximately 85% of the net volume delivered to BLP in 2016 was from Idaho Pro-Loggers. All contractors are required to comply with BMP s in their contracts. All log purchase contracts contain requirements to meet BMP s and Bennett Lumber Products procurement policies. BLP has a wet weather policy and relies on IDL FPA and BMP requirements. In Idaho, the Idaho Department of Lands (IDL) inspects many of the forest practices notifications that are taken out annually. Monitoring by the IDL is considered very robust and is relied upon for evaluation of BMP s throughout the State. The IDL inspection rate for BLP-Princeton NIPF jobs was 27% for The IDL inspection rate for BLP-Clarkson NIPF jobs was 38%. Four jobs had unsatisfactory conditions that were later revised to satisfactory. All core contractors were inspected were satisfactory. The IDL publishes an annual monitoring report that is used by BLP in conjunction with their own monitoring reports to identify potential areas of improvement. In Washington State, Bennett foresters from the Clarkston office conduct random field audits of their procurement system. Approximately ten percent of the sites are inspected. BLP foresters collect, review and summarize the field inspection reports to keep informed of BMP compliance. -2- Bureau Veritas Certification SFI Fiber Sourcing Audit Report Jan 2015
3 Objective 3-Use of Qualified Resource and Qualified Logging Professionals: Approximately 85% of the net volume delivered to BLP in 2016 was from Pro-Loggers. All Bennett Lumber logging contractors are trained and they strongly encourage all contractors delivering logs to the Bennett mills to become trained. BLP maintains a complete list of all qualified loggers. The Idaho Pro-Logger list can also be found on the Associated Contract Loggers Association (ALC) and Washington Contract Logging Association (WCLA) websites. Objective 4, Legal and Regulatory Compliance: The Site Activity Plan/Report provides a defined system to address specific requirements to meet all applicable laws and regulations. Bennett Lumber utilizes site visits and follows BMP Procedures to ensure compliance. These visits and checklists note compliance with all laws and regulations. IDL regulatory staff monitor for regulatory compliance. No Forest Practices Notice of Violations was issued by the IDL against any of Bennett Lumber operations last year. Bennett Lumber commits to compliance with social laws as outlined in its employee handbook. No complaints were issued in 2016 against Bennett Lumber by its employees or subcontractors regarding the three ILO core conventions. The Employee handbook has policies on EEO and Harassment. The National Labor Relations Act (NLRA) covers most private-sector employers. All applicable policies were posted in the Bennett Lumber office and building entrance. Health and Safety requirements are met and requirements are posted in various locations as prescribed by law. Objective 5, Forestry Research, Science and Technology: Bennett Lumber Products is either involved with or provides financial support to various agencies for research. It is very active in a number of ventures being monitored by the Intermountain Forest Tree Nutrition Coop, USDA Forest Service and University of Idaho. This may involve collecting data, baseline direct funding, direct technical support covering research related to tree improvement, nutrient effect on future forest activities, and response to thinning site type effects on stocking and density management.
